Description

Folios 234-235: William Croft, Hull Rendezvous. Regarding the insufficient payment to the keepers of houses of correction for the transportation of deserters back to a rendezvous; also enclosing a letter from Mr Strawbenzee in Wakefield regarding his costs.

Folios 236-237: enclosure with folios 234-235. Letter dated 16 August 1812 by C Strawbenzee in Wakefield to Croft. Regarding the costs of returning two deserters, including a John Burn who is unable to walk and complaining that he is now much out of pocket.
